数据恢复咨询热线:400-666-3702  

欢迎访问南京兆柏数据恢复公司,专业数据恢复15年

兆柏数据恢复公司

 行业新闻

 当前位置: 主页 > 行业新闻

oracle 集群

浏览量: 次 发布日期:2023-11-13 03:08:38

1. 引言

    Oracle集群是 Oracle 数据库服务器在共享磁盘和多处理器系统上运行的平台,通过 Oracle 集群软件来创建高可用性和高性能的数据库系统。Oracle 集群可以确保应用程序的高可用性,减少停机时间,并提供更高的性能。

    

    2. Oracle集群技术概述

    Oracle 集群使用共享磁盘架构,其中所有节点都可以访问共享存储器,并且每个节点都有自己的处理器和内存。Oracle 集群包括 Oracle 数据库软件、Oracle 集群软件和共享存储设备。

    

    3. Oracle集群架构与组件

    Oracle 集群由多个节点组成,每个节点运行自己的 Oracle 数据库实例。Oracle 集群包括以下组件:

     Oracle RAC(Real Applicaio Clusers):这是 Oracle 的集群数据库软件,可以提供高可用性和高性能。

     Oracle Cluserware:这是 Oracle 的集群中间件,可以管理集群中的所有节点和资源。

     Oracle Grid Ifrasrucure(GI):这是 Oracle 的集群存储软件,可以提供共享存储器访问所有节点。

     Oracle Daabase Sofware:这是 Oracle 的数据库软件,可以运行在 Oracle 集群中的每个节点上。

    

    4. Oracle集群安装与配置

    安装和配置 Oracle 集群需要以下步骤:

     在每个节点上安装 Oracle Daabase Sofware。

     在共享存储设备上创建卷并分配给每个节点。

     在每个节点上安装 Oracle Cluserware 和 Oracle Grid Ifrasrucure。

     配置网络和 DS,以确保所有节点可以相互通信。

     配置数据库参数和环境变量,以便每个节点可以访问共享存储设备和彼此的数据库实例。

    

    5. Oracle集群高可用性

    Oracle 集群提供高可用性,因为如果一个节点发生故障,其他节点将接管该节点的任务并继续运行。这可以通过以下技术实现:

     自动切换:当一个节点发生故障时,另一个节点可以自动接管任务并继续运行。

     手动切换:管理员可以手动将任务从一个节点切换到另一个节点。

     数据备份和恢复:Oracle 集群使用数据备份和恢复技术来确保数据的高可用性。

    

    6. Oracle集群性能优化

    Oracle 集群可以通过以下方法进行性能优化:

     并行查询:Oracle 集群可以将大型查询分解为多个小查询,并在多个节点上并行执行,以加快查询速度。

     并行数据写操作:Oracle 集群可以将大型数据写操作分解为多个小操作,并在多个节点上并行执行,以加快写入速度。

    负载均衡:Oracle集群可以将负载分配给各个节点,以确保所有节点都得到充分利用,并提高整体性能。

    

    7. Oracle集群管理与监控

    Oracle 集群需要定期进行管理和监控,以确保其正常运行和高性能。这可以通过以下工具和技术实现:

     Oracle Eerprise Maager(OEM):这是一个 Web 界面工具,可以用于管理和监控 Oracle 数据库和 Oracle 集群。

     SQL Plus 和 SQL Developer:这些是用于管理和监控 Oracle 数据库的传统工具。


相关推荐